Attendees are muted
Ask questions under Q&A section of Zoom
A recording of this session will be shared
Post-event feedback survey will be given at the end
Log into your Postman account for this session
(go.postman.co)
1
2
3
4
5
General Information
@getpostman @petuniaGray @poojamakes
All rights reserved by Postman Inc
API testing Beyond the
Basics : AI & Automation
Techniques
Joyce Lin
Senior director of
developer relations
Pooja Mistry
Developer Advocate
Senior Director of Developer Relations
Joyce Lin
Developer Advocate
Pooja Mistry
@petuniaGray
@poojamakes
At the end of this session, you will be able to:
● Harness the automation capabilities of Postman to conduct tests across
diverse environments.
● Amplify the potential of Postman's scripting interface by incorporating
pre-request scripts, assertions, variables, and libraries.
● Employ Postbot, an AI-powered assistant that interprets natural language
input to aid in testing, debugging, data visualization, and data analysis.
● Cultivate proficiency in testing intricate API workflows, encompassing
scenarios with multiple API endpoints, conditional logic, and data
manipulation
Learning Objectives
@getpostman @petuniaGray @poojamakes
Agenda
1 What is testing in Postman?
2 Means of test automation
3 Postbot
5 Resources and Q&A
4 Demo
@getpostman @petuniaGray @poojamakes
● Participate in the Poll
○ Which type of tests do you run in
Postman?
A little about you
@getpostman @petuniaGray @poojamakes
Do you even test APIs?
Tests and Test Results
Postman tests
– BDD assertions
● Chai.js BDD syntax
● pm.expect()
predicate expression
that can be evaluated
to a boolean value
@getpostman @petuniaGray @poojamakes
API Testing Methods
@getpostman @petuniaGray @poojamakes
Postbot, Postman’s new AI assistant
● Write tests
● Visualize responses
● Write FQL in Postman Flows
● Write documentation
@getpostman @petuniaGray @poojamakes
Demo
www.postman.com/postman/workspace/postman-intergalactic
Postbot testing
@getpostman @petuniaGray @poojamakes
Demo
https://www.postman.com/postman/workspace/test-examples-in-postman/
Test Automation
@getpostman @petuniaGray @poojamakes
Means of Test Automation
@getpostman @petuniaGray @poojamakes
Tips for writing better Postman tests
Group multiple
assertions
● Keep them logically
organized for those
who review the test
results and need to
debug issues
Use messages and
console
statements
● Provide visibility to
validate conditional
testing and execution
order
● Prepend custom
messages
Use descriptive,
consistent, or
dynamic test
names
● Use variables within
test names to provide
more detail, especially
if the same test is used
for multiple scenarios
or iterations
@getpostman @petuniaGray @poojamakes
@getpostman @petuniaGray @arlemi
loopdelicious.github.io/postman-skills/
What we learned today:
● Types of testing you can run in Postman
● Testing API workflows with Postbot
● Types of automation capabilities tests across diverse environments.
● Postman's collaboration features to manage test suites, share results with
team members
In summary
@getpostman @petuniaGray @poojamakes
Postman API Test Automation for Beginners - Valentin Despa
https://www.youtube.com/watch?v=zp5Jh2FIpF0
15 Days of Postman - for Testers
postman.com/postman/workspace/15-days-of-postman-for-testers/overview
Test examples in Postman
postman.com/postman/workspace/test-examples-in-postman/overview
Quickstarts: hands-on tutorials
quickstarts.postman.com
Additional Resources
@getpostman @petuniaGray @poojamakes
Please tell us about
your experience!
FEEDBACK SURVEY
@getpostman @petuniaGray @poojamakes
tinyurl.com/ai-automation-techniques
Thank You
@getpostman @petuniaGray @poojamakes

More Related Content

PDF
Advanced Testing
PDF
POST/CON 2019 Workshop: Testing, Automated Testing, and Reporting APIs with P...
PDF
Robot Framework Introduction
PDF
Postman: An Introduction for Developers
PDF
Ruin your life using robot framework
PDF
automation testing benefits
PDF
Postman Webinar: Postman 101
PPT
Postman.ppt
Advanced Testing
POST/CON 2019 Workshop: Testing, Automated Testing, and Reporting APIs with P...
Robot Framework Introduction
Postman: An Introduction for Developers
Ruin your life using robot framework
automation testing benefits
Postman Webinar: Postman 101
Postman.ppt

What's hot (20)

PDF
Karate - powerful and simple framework for REST API automation testing
PPTX
Trunk based development and Canary deployment
PDF
Argo Workflows 3.0, a detailed look at what’s new from the Argo Team
PPTX
Karate DSL
PDF
Matomo: A guide to your site's usage
PDF
Why we chose Argo Workflow to scale DevOps at InVision
PPTX
The tests are trying to tell you [email protected]
PDF
Apache Airflow in the Cloud: Programmatically orchestrating workloads with Py...
ODP
Python unit testing
PDF
API Testing following the Test Pyramid
PDF
JUnit5 and TestContainers
PDF
Effective testing with pytest
PDF
TDC2015: Testes em APIs REST com Rest-Assured
PDF
Advanced Streaming Analytics with Apache Flink and Apache Kafka, Stephan Ewen
PDF
DevCamp - O papel de um testador em uma equipe ágil
PDF
AI assisted testing using postman and openAI.pdf
PDF
Robot Framework :: Demo login application
PDF
How to Automate API Testing
PPTX
Test Design and Automation for REST API
PPTX
Postman An Introduction for Testers, October 26 2022.pptx
Karate - powerful and simple framework for REST API automation testing
Trunk based development and Canary deployment
Argo Workflows 3.0, a detailed look at what’s new from the Argo Team
Karate DSL
Matomo: A guide to your site's usage
Why we chose Argo Workflow to scale DevOps at InVision
The tests are trying to tell you [email protected]
Apache Airflow in the Cloud: Programmatically orchestrating workloads with Py...
Python unit testing
API Testing following the Test Pyramid
JUnit5 and TestContainers
Effective testing with pytest
TDC2015: Testes em APIs REST com Rest-Assured
Advanced Streaming Analytics with Apache Flink and Apache Kafka, Stephan Ewen
DevCamp - O papel de um testador em uma equipe ágil
AI assisted testing using postman and openAI.pdf
Robot Framework :: Demo login application
How to Automate API Testing
Test Design and Automation for REST API
Postman An Introduction for Testers, October 26 2022.pptx
Ad

Similar to API testing Beyond the Basics AI & Automation Techniques (20)

PDF
Five Ways to Automate API Testing with Postman
PDF
Advanced AI and Documentation Techniques
PDF
Continuous Quality with Postman
PDF
WeTestAthens: Postman's AI & Automation Techniques
PDF
Intergalactic - Collaboration and Governance for API Teams
DOC
Joy Banerjee (Test Automation Engineer)
PDF
Space Camp - API Contract Testing
DOCX
Anupam_Resume
PDF
Ayush Goyal - Automation Testing Resume
PPTX
API automation with JMeter + Bamboo CI
PDF
Eradicate Flaky Tests
PDF
Eradicate Flaky Tests - AppiumConf 2021
PDF
Pankaj python programmer
PDF
API Lifecycle, Part 2: Monitor and Deploy an API
PDF
The Best Postman Alternatives to Streamline API Testing.pdf
PPTX
Ui Testing with Ghost Inspector
PDF
PDF
Designing Good API Experiences Session 24
DOC
Jayanth_Resume
DOC
Pradeep.CL
Five Ways to Automate API Testing with Postman
Advanced AI and Documentation Techniques
Continuous Quality with Postman
WeTestAthens: Postman's AI & Automation Techniques
Intergalactic - Collaboration and Governance for API Teams
Joy Banerjee (Test Automation Engineer)
Space Camp - API Contract Testing
Anupam_Resume
Ayush Goyal - Automation Testing Resume
API automation with JMeter + Bamboo CI
Eradicate Flaky Tests
Eradicate Flaky Tests - AppiumConf 2021
Pankaj python programmer
API Lifecycle, Part 2: Monitor and Deploy an API
The Best Postman Alternatives to Streamline API Testing.pdf
Ui Testing with Ghost Inspector
Designing Good API Experiences Session 24
Jayanth_Resume
Pradeep.CL
Ad

More from Postman (20)

PDF
Elevating Developer Experiences with AI-Powered API Testing & Documentation
PDF
Discovering Public APIs and Public API Network with Postman
PDF
Optimizing Teamwork: Harnessing Collections & Workspaces for Collaboration
PDF
Not Your Grandma’s Rate Limiting (slides)
PDF
How to Scale APIs-as-Product for Future Success
PPTX
Revolutionizing API Development: Collaborative Workflows with Postman
PDF
Everything You Always Wanted to Know About AsyncAPI
PDF
Elevating Event-Driven World: A Deep Dive into AsyncAPI v3
PDF
Five Things You SHOULD Know About Postman
PDF
Integration-, Snapshot- and Performance-Testing APIs
PDF
How ChatGPT led OpenAPI's Recent Spike in Popularity
PDF
Exploring Postman’s VS Code Extension
PDF
2023 State of the API Report: Key Findings and Trends
PDF
Nordic- APIOps is here What will you build in an API First World
PDF
Testing and Developing gRPC APIs
PDF
Testing and Developing GraphQL APIs
PDF
Introduction to API Security - Intergalactic
PDF
Unboxing What's New in Postman Q2
PDF
Building Low-Code Applications with Postman Flows
PDF
Postman Intergalactic - API Observability
Elevating Developer Experiences with AI-Powered API Testing & Documentation
Discovering Public APIs and Public API Network with Postman
Optimizing Teamwork: Harnessing Collections & Workspaces for Collaboration
Not Your Grandma’s Rate Limiting (slides)
How to Scale APIs-as-Product for Future Success
Revolutionizing API Development: Collaborative Workflows with Postman
Everything You Always Wanted to Know About AsyncAPI
Elevating Event-Driven World: A Deep Dive into AsyncAPI v3
Five Things You SHOULD Know About Postman
Integration-, Snapshot- and Performance-Testing APIs
How ChatGPT led OpenAPI's Recent Spike in Popularity
Exploring Postman’s VS Code Extension
2023 State of the API Report: Key Findings and Trends
Nordic- APIOps is here What will you build in an API First World
Testing and Developing gRPC APIs
Testing and Developing GraphQL APIs
Introduction to API Security - Intergalactic
Unboxing What's New in Postman Q2
Building Low-Code Applications with Postman Flows
Postman Intergalactic - API Observability

Recently uploaded (20)

PDF
Applying Agentic AI in Enterprise Automation
PDF
NewMind AI Journal Monthly Chronicles - August 2025
PPTX
Presentation - Principles of Instructional Design.pptx
PDF
eBook Outline_ AI in Cybersecurity – The Future of Digital Defense.pdf
PPTX
Rise of the Digital Control Grid Zeee Media and Hope and Tivon FTWProject.com
PDF
Ebook - The Future of AI A Comprehensive Guide.pdf
PDF
Uncertainty-aware contextual multi-armed bandits for recommendations in e-com...
PPT
Overviiew on Intellectual property right
PDF
Secure Java Applications against Quantum Threats
PDF
GDG Cloud Southlake #45: Patrick Debois: The Impact of GenAI on Development a...
PPTX
Report in SIP_Distance_Learning_Technology_Impact.pptx
PPTX
From Curiosity to ROI — Cost-Benefit Analysis of Agentic Automation [3/6]
PDF
Child-friendly e-learning for artificial intelligence education in Indonesia:...
PPTX
Introduction-to-Artificial-Intelligence (1).pptx
PDF
The Basics of Artificial Intelligence - Understanding the Key Concepts and Te...
PDF
Domain-specific knowledge and context in large language models: challenges, c...
PDF
“Introduction to Designing with AI Agents,” a Presentation from Amazon Web Se...
PDF
Decision Optimization - From Theory to Practice
PPTX
CRM(Customer Relationship Managmnet) Presentation
PDF
Addressing the challenges of harmonizing law and artificial intelligence tech...
Applying Agentic AI in Enterprise Automation
NewMind AI Journal Monthly Chronicles - August 2025
Presentation - Principles of Instructional Design.pptx
eBook Outline_ AI in Cybersecurity – The Future of Digital Defense.pdf
Rise of the Digital Control Grid Zeee Media and Hope and Tivon FTWProject.com
Ebook - The Future of AI A Comprehensive Guide.pdf
Uncertainty-aware contextual multi-armed bandits for recommendations in e-com...
Overviiew on Intellectual property right
Secure Java Applications against Quantum Threats
GDG Cloud Southlake #45: Patrick Debois: The Impact of GenAI on Development a...
Report in SIP_Distance_Learning_Technology_Impact.pptx
From Curiosity to ROI — Cost-Benefit Analysis of Agentic Automation [3/6]
Child-friendly e-learning for artificial intelligence education in Indonesia:...
Introduction-to-Artificial-Intelligence (1).pptx
The Basics of Artificial Intelligence - Understanding the Key Concepts and Te...
Domain-specific knowledge and context in large language models: challenges, c...
“Introduction to Designing with AI Agents,” a Presentation from Amazon Web Se...
Decision Optimization - From Theory to Practice
CRM(Customer Relationship Managmnet) Presentation
Addressing the challenges of harmonizing law and artificial intelligence tech...

API testing Beyond the Basics AI & Automation Techniques

  • 1. Attendees are muted Ask questions under Q&A section of Zoom A recording of this session will be shared Post-event feedback survey will be given at the end Log into your Postman account for this session (go.postman.co) 1 2 3 4 5 General Information @getpostman @petuniaGray @poojamakes
  • 2. All rights reserved by Postman Inc API testing Beyond the Basics : AI & Automation Techniques Joyce Lin Senior director of developer relations Pooja Mistry Developer Advocate
  • 3. Senior Director of Developer Relations Joyce Lin Developer Advocate Pooja Mistry @petuniaGray @poojamakes
  • 4. At the end of this session, you will be able to: ● Harness the automation capabilities of Postman to conduct tests across diverse environments. ● Amplify the potential of Postman's scripting interface by incorporating pre-request scripts, assertions, variables, and libraries. ● Employ Postbot, an AI-powered assistant that interprets natural language input to aid in testing, debugging, data visualization, and data analysis. ● Cultivate proficiency in testing intricate API workflows, encompassing scenarios with multiple API endpoints, conditional logic, and data manipulation Learning Objectives @getpostman @petuniaGray @poojamakes
  • 5. Agenda 1 What is testing in Postman? 2 Means of test automation 3 Postbot 5 Resources and Q&A 4 Demo @getpostman @petuniaGray @poojamakes
  • 6. ● Participate in the Poll ○ Which type of tests do you run in Postman? A little about you @getpostman @petuniaGray @poojamakes
  • 7. Do you even test APIs?
  • 8. Tests and Test Results Postman tests – BDD assertions ● Chai.js BDD syntax ● pm.expect() predicate expression that can be evaluated to a boolean value @getpostman @petuniaGray @poojamakes
  • 9. API Testing Methods @getpostman @petuniaGray @poojamakes
  • 10. Postbot, Postman’s new AI assistant ● Write tests ● Visualize responses ● Write FQL in Postman Flows ● Write documentation @getpostman @petuniaGray @poojamakes
  • 13. Means of Test Automation @getpostman @petuniaGray @poojamakes
  • 14. Tips for writing better Postman tests Group multiple assertions ● Keep them logically organized for those who review the test results and need to debug issues Use messages and console statements ● Provide visibility to validate conditional testing and execution order ● Prepend custom messages Use descriptive, consistent, or dynamic test names ● Use variables within test names to provide more detail, especially if the same test is used for multiple scenarios or iterations @getpostman @petuniaGray @poojamakes
  • 16. What we learned today: ● Types of testing you can run in Postman ● Testing API workflows with Postbot ● Types of automation capabilities tests across diverse environments. ● Postman's collaboration features to manage test suites, share results with team members In summary @getpostman @petuniaGray @poojamakes
  • 17. Postman API Test Automation for Beginners - Valentin Despa https://www.youtube.com/watch?v=zp5Jh2FIpF0 15 Days of Postman - for Testers postman.com/postman/workspace/15-days-of-postman-for-testers/overview Test examples in Postman postman.com/postman/workspace/test-examples-in-postman/overview Quickstarts: hands-on tutorials quickstarts.postman.com Additional Resources @getpostman @petuniaGray @poojamakes
  • 18. Please tell us about your experience! FEEDBACK SURVEY @getpostman @petuniaGray @poojamakes tinyurl.com/ai-automation-techniques